Output 80c7c826598decaf1c6ff11dede14570ea27bc8e8daf4030520fa2f58d5cbffb:0

value
623479
script pubkey
OP_HASH160 OP_PUSHBYTES_20 059a010e3bc1927f6a57df482b74a98525946fbe OP_EQUAL
address
32Cdntyjh1nii6JjVwiZeLhFy3KDhJcyEQ
transaction
80c7c826598decaf1c6ff11dede14570ea27bc8e8daf4030520fa2f58d5cbffb
confirmations
175816
spent
true